#39df68 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#39df68 is composed of 22.4% red, 87.5%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.4%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 137 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 54.9%. #39df68 color hex could be obtained by blending #72ffd0 with #00bf00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

● #39df68 color description : Bright c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#39df68 has RGB values of R:57, G:223,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 3792744.
